Mysticus C* Posted May 26, 2008 Author Share Posted May 26, 2008 download the files in windows and put them on a flash disk, keep the flash disk in usb slot, and restart, to osx ... usb should mount, and you can install the rest from there... which part is hard? i dont understand... about your original updates fact; since you are on nforce chipset, before going for major updates or special ones time to time, make sure you check the forum's front page, there is usually warning over there, if not ask for it on this topic...(like time machine fix which introduced new kernel, and some other things that crashes nforce chipsets...) what updates are safe? + usually single program updates like for iphoto, quicktime, itunes, safari etc are safe + securiy updates should be safe as well... what may not be safe? + Gfx updates, check if it supports your gfx card? + gfx firmware == dangerous! + major updates like 10.5.2 or upcomin 10.5.3... + special updates like time machine update which brings new network files and kernel and some other stuffs... which indeed will make your os temporarily bricked (not in real terms, bcoz solutions are pretty easy when you know what to do) there are ways to install these updates but first you must learn to search and read! most people dont have this habit, many people are advanterous a bit and they first brick their system, and then ask for reason... Mysticus C* Posted May 27, 2008 Author Share Posted May 27, 2008 @tw34k: when you start the pc, before it goes to osx boot, it should show a countdown message from 5secs and saying press any key... just press any key, and than type -v and press enter this will show your error messages, please take screen shots of everything untill it gets stuck... @breaking bad: stop giving advices to people until you learn what is happening on your own system... for the bios update, it is your own risk at this stage! wheter you wanna take the risk or continue having the problem, and nag at this topic which you will not have any more answer for... because you need to eliminate all the obstacles first before we can help you, if you dont eliminate, we cant give you any more advices... most asus mobos have built in flashing utility in bios, just place the bios firmware in a floppy? or in a usb flash memory, and place it before you start the system, once in the bios, go to flash utility menu, and do it from there... make a back up of your bios before you start so you can reverse it (most asus mobos have dual bios in case one of them doomed you can reverse it from the other one...) good luck... @juplia: check your bios settings first: enable: execute disable bit acpi suspend mode: S3 hpet: not important but keep it enabled sata mode: ahci (dont use native ide modes! only use ahci) after these try using kalyway 10.5.2 dvd again! if it doesnt work still (if it keeps restarting again) you may have some funny chipset that is not supported by OSX, one last time after press f8 screen (make sure you press f8), type -v cpus=1 if this doesnt help, sorry no luck for you...
